
we watched the opening of jumanji and studied the cinematography used in the opening. an establishing shot was used to set the scene at the start where the two young boys are in the woods approaching the jumanji box. close ups were used to show the emotion on the boys face when he fell into the hole and again after he was beaten up. a two shot was used to show the boys together and there expressions. p.o.v shot was to used show Alan parish view of the boys outside and helps emphasise with him (the main character). tracking shot was used to show the bully's in pursuit of alan in the bike chase, the shot helps increase the tempo and adds tension. A high angle shot was used on the bully's to make them look bigger and scarier and a low angle shot was used on alan parish to make him look smaller than the bully's.
